316L L-PBF fatigue dataset

Authors: MEROT, Pierre; GALLEGOS MAYORGA, Linamaria; MOREL, Franck; PESSARD, Etienne; BUTTIN, Paul; BAFFIE, Thierry;
Abstract

This file contains 316L Laser Powder Bed Fusion fatigue tests dataset. Experiments were carried on a MTS Landmark 100 kN servohydraulic fatigue test machine. This experimental campaign took place in the context of a PhD grant from the French region Pays de la Loire (see https://pastel.archives-ouvertes.fr/tel-03688021 for the thesis manuscript). Fatigue tests were carried : - in air or in salt-spray - on different batches (polished, pre-corroded, with artificial defects,...) - at R=-1 and R=0.1
